Chase Me Home furniture resale in Gresham
Chase Me Home Antiques, Reclaimed Art and Used Furniture – Located on the corner of 2nd & Hood in downtown Gresham

Our favorite local secondhand clothing store, Chase Me Again, recently opened a consignment furniture shop. Conveniently located right next door, Chase Me Home sells secondhand furniture and home items. Some pieces are individually consigned while others are set up into cultivated booths. On our first visit this week, the husband and I found a couch we absolutely loved (and at a great price!) but unfortunately it was already on hold. We’ll definitely be checking back often! Sebastian loved the new shop too. It isn’t exactly a kid-friendly store but he did really well, practicing his “nice hands” with delicate objects – Gotta start him on antiquing young! Like Chase Me Again, Chase Me Home has awesome, affordable prices. They could probably charge a lot more but shhh, don’t tell them that! — In all seriousness, both stores have a great heart, with profits benefiting My Father’s House Family Shelter. I love that my dollars & donations help local families, and that their stores themselves are accessible to those with limited income.
